Measurement Accuracy Standards
Measurement accuracy is the cornerstone of reliable electronic testers for bullion rounds, as even small deviations can lead to incorrect assessments of purity. Industry standards like ASTM and ISO set benchmarks that guarantee consistency and trustworthiness in results. High-quality testers should achieve an accuracy margin of less than 0.1% in density or specific gravity readings, which is critical for precise purity determination. Regular calibration against certified reference materials is crucial to maintain this accuracy and stay compliant with industry standards. Environmental factors, such as temperature fluctuations, can impact measurements, so choosing a tester with low temperature drift is advisable. Additionally, routine maintenance and calibration checks are indispensable to sustain measurement precision over time, ensuring reliable and accurate testing results.

Sensor and Microprocessor Quality
The quality of sensors and microprocessors plays an essential role in the accuracy and reliability of electronic testers for bullion rounds. High-quality sensors, like HBM sensors, ensure precise density measurements, which are critical for verifying bullion purity. A microprocessor with advanced control capabilities improves consistency and reduces measurement errors. Low temperature drift in both sensors and microprocessors minimizes inaccuracies caused by environmental changes, guaranteeing stable readings. Overload protection within the microprocessor system prevents damage from excessive samples, extending the device’s lifespan. When these components are integrated effectively, they deliver faster, more accurate results, making your bullion verification process more efficient and trustworthy. Choosing a tester with top-tier sensors and microprocessors guarantees precise, dependable assessments, which are indispensable for authenticating bullion rounds confidently.
